Weekend forecast
Showers and thunderstorms will move through this weekend. The high pressure system that has kept us hot and mostly dry will move south. This could bring unsettled weather that will bring showers on both Saturday and Sunday. Mizzou’s home game could be wet, so be sure to bring a rain jacket!
When it’s all over, most of Mid-Missouri will have received over 1″ of rainfall where heavier rains have developed, possibly more. I can’t rule out a few isolated severe storms on Sunday, but overall little to no severe weather is expected.
Temperatures will also begin to cool down this weekend. On Saturday temperatures will rise to over 30 degrees and on Sunday to below 25 degrees.
